Latest Patents
Kurupathi's latest patents include groundbreaking compositions and processes for forming radiopaque polymeric articles. These articles are designed to be detectable by radiation inspection apparatuses, allowing for the determination of their presence and attributes. The radiopaque polymeric articles can be created by mixing radiopaque materials, such as barium, bismuth, and tungsten, with various forms of polymers. This innovation not only facilitates the creation of radiation-detectable objects but also leads to the development of radiation protective articles, including garments and bomb containment vessels. Furthermore, the use of nano-materials enhances the level of radiation protection provided by these materials. The principles of Kurupathi's inventions can also be applied to protect against other hazards, such as fire, chemical, biological, and projectile threats.
